Owensboro Symphony is a nonprofit organization committed to engaging the community with quality programming. The Owensboro Symphony presents a broad range of programs and services for the benefit and enjoyment of the region it serves. Professional, classically trained musicians are engaged to perform great music and deliver the orchestra's mission - to create meaningful, imaginative performances and educational programs that enrich lives and create memorable experiences.

JOB SUMMARY: This administrative position will act as part of the Executive Team and will plan and manage season subscriptions and renewal campaigns; all ticket sales (including box office management); resource development materials; and new subscriber activities, as well as multiple other administrative duties.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Subscription Sales and Management
- Oversee the acquisition of prospect lists for all direct mail as well as email databases.
- Monitor the progress of all campaigns and provide progress reports and analyses of results.
- Manage in-house box office and monitor outside ticket venue operations, ensuring friendly, courteous service and customer satisfaction in ticket transactions.
- Distribution of all campaign print materials as needed.
- Oversee the planning and development of special public relations events.
- Coordinate volunteers to participate in special events and campaigns.
Administrative
- Manage all day-to-day office activity.
- Maintain the accuracy of website.
- Maintain grant filings in conjunction with the CEO.
Patron Services
- Maintain donor database and generate appropriate acknowledgments for gifts.
- Communicate with ticket buyers, donors, and sponsors on an as-needed basis.
- Attend all events and act as liaison to the patrons.
Other
- Participate in artist hospitality as requested.
- Assist in community engagement efforts by promoting outreach events, disbursement of tickets, etc.
- Perform other duties as assigned by the CEO.
QUALIFICATIONS
- A team builder with outstanding communication skills who will contribute to a positive, collegial, good-humored work atmosphere to get results in a fast-paced, high-pressure, deadline-oriented environment.
- High level of professionalism and to handle confidential information.
- Computer proficiency including all products in Microsoft Office Suite.
- Strong attention to detail and ability to work on multiple projects simultaneously.
- The discipline to work independently, but also the ability to function as a member of a team.
